Job Description

Overview:

The National Federation of Independent Business (NFIB), the nation’s largest small business advocacy organization, is looking to hire a Content Writer & Coordinator to join its Public Affairs team.  

Responsibilities:

The Content Writer & Coordinator writes , edits, and publishes high volumes of internal and external content that powers NFIB’s print, digital , email, and social media marketing and communication materials in alignment with strategic NFIB initiatives. This position serves as a conduit to other NFIB departments and writes and edits compelling content that drives member engagement. Collaborates with the digital and communications team s to adapt/create content that is search-friendly and channel appropriate .  

 

Collaborates with the Senior Content Manager and other members of the content team to develop and execute content strategy and acts as a resource, liaison, and consultant to other departments on content creation and publication.  

 

Strong editing and writing skills , the ability to manage multiple priorities and projects at once , and strong collaboration skills are a must . Content Writer & Coordinator will be an organized self-starter with the ability to manage time and projects, communicate, and manage up and around. Must use sound judgment and discernment.  

 

Must communicate effectively both verbally and in writing . Adhere to Company and Department policies and procedures ; work outcomes must meet and/or exceed productivity and quality standards. Must be able to work as part of a cooperative team environment and independent of direct supervision . Responsibilities include reinforcing key organizational messages to foster employee understanding of NFIB mission and vision; exemplifies core values. Performs other projects as needed.  

Salary Range for position - $60,000-70,000

Position is hybrid – must work in the DC office.

Qualifications:
  1. Bachelor’s degree in j ournalism, c ommunication, m arketing, or a related field.  
  2. One or two years of writing and edi ting experience , or comparable internship and college work experience.  
  3. Writer with knowledge of the following: digital and print editorial content; copy writing and editing using AP Style ; developing editorial calendars; integrated social media approaches; publishing using content management systems. Familiarity with keyword placement and SEO a plus.  
  4. Proficient in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, Outlook and PowerPoint). Experience with WordPress, Canva, Asana, and Adobe Creative Suite preferred but not required .  
  5. Excellent time and project management skills. Strong written and verbal communication skills. Self-starter who can work independently or support others when necessary.  
  6. Highly organized with the ability to plan effectively, handle multiple, shifting priorities under tight deadlines, collaborate with multiple stakeholders, and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ment with an emphasis on public affairs advocacy and association membership.
